Ferrara, Italy โ A 50-year-old woman, identified as Samanta Zironi, was found dead in her apartment late last night, allegedly murdered by her husband, 52-year-old Vladimiro Lombardi. Emergency medical services, alerted by Lombardi himself, arrived at the scene but could only confirm Zironi's death.
Lombardi was taken into custody and transferred to the police station. He has reportedly exercised his right to remain silent and has not yet responded to initial questioning by the public prosecutor. Early findings suggest Zironi sustained multiple stab wounds.
Authorities are currently investigating the circumstances surrounding the death. This includes reviewing any previous reports of domestic abuse and gathering information from neighbors and acquaintances to piece together the events leading up to the tragedy.
